The Mira Costa High School astonished the audience with passionate detail and extraordinary performances during the annual orchestra Winter Concert.

Mira Costa’s Grammy award-winning orchestra features many talented students who showcase their passion for music through their breath-taking performances. The orchestra entertained listeners with diverse instrumental harmonies and fluid tempos while delivering precise renditions of well-known pieces.

The Orchestra’s Winter Concert occurred on Dec. 1 in the Costa  Auditorium. The production featured four separate ensembles: the Philharmonic Orchestra, the Sinfonietta, the Chamber Orchestra and the Symphony Orchestra.

The music’s constant change of tempo kept the audience’s attention throughout the concert. Each song had a mixture of chaos and tranquility, as some areas were brisk and others were slow.

The musicians added to the enjoyability of the Winter Concert by passionately moving along to the songs. While playing, the musicians swayed to the tempo of the songs, showing their focus on the music.

The moods of the various songs added to the winter theme of the concert. In “Serenade for String Orchestra,” played by the Philharmonic Orchestra, the mood was ominous and cheerful at various moments, adding boldness to the performance. Additionally, the lights that illuminated the musicians subtly hinted at the concept and mood of each song.

The Orchestra Winter Concert was exceptional, with immaculate details and magnificent performances from all Orchestra ensembles. The tempo changes in the songs kept the audience’s attention and reeled them in for more. The instruments’ creative harmonization was inventive and added to the enjoyment of the concert.

The orchestra’s next concert, the All-District Orchestra Festival, will take place on Feb, 8 in the Costa auditorium. A full calendar of orchestra events can be found at mchsorchestra.com.
